HC Deb 29 January 1991 vol 184 cc444-5W
Mr. Higgins

To ask the Secretary of State for Transport if he will take steps to expedite the compensation due from British Rail to the widow of one of the constituents of the right hon. Member for Worthing whose husband was killed in the Clapham train crash; and if he will raise the matter when he next has a discussion with British Rail.

Mr. Freeman

Compensation is a matter for British Rail and ultimately the courts. My right hon. and learned Friend the Secretary of State has no powers to intervene in individual cases, but will certainly discuss the general progress of claims when he next meets the chairman of British Rail.
